Visual analysis of the research status of pressurized intraperitoneal aerosol chemotherapy from 2013 to 2023 based on CiteSpace software
Objective To investigate the research trends of pressurized intraperitoneal aerosol chemothera-py(PIPAC)over the past decade,both domestically and internationally.Methods CiteSpace software was used to analyze the core data of PIPAC studies retrieved from the Web of Science database from 2013 to 2023.Visual analysis was conducted to examine the publication volumes,authors,institutions,countries/regions,keyword frequency,clustering and the temporal trends.Results A total of 397 relevant papers were identi-fied from 2013 to 2023.The year 2022 witnessed the highest volume of publications,with individual authors and institutions contributing up to 32 and 55 papers,respectively.Germany was the country with the highest publication output.The keywords of research focused on"peritoneal carcinomatosis"(112 times),"doxorubi-cin"(92 times)and"carcinomatosis"(88 times).Temporal trend analysis showed that in the past two years,relevant research focused on"systemic chemotherapy","hyperthermic intraperitoneal chemotherapy"and"per-itoneal metastases".Conclusion The escalating research interest in pressurized intraperitoneal aerosol chem-otherapy underscores its growing importance.Addressing this gap necessitates concerted efforts in further re-search,collaboration,and knowledge exchange among nations,fostering the scientific and standardized ad-vancement of pressurized intraperitoneal aerosol chemotherapy application.
